Causes of Wrong-Way Incidents

Generally, head-on collisions result from drastic events that place vehicles in the direct path of each other. Some common causes of wrong-way collisions include:

  • Driver Error: Accidents that occur when drivers travel in the wrong direction are often due to mistakes made by the driver. This can include confusion, intoxication, distraction, or fatigue.
  • Poor Signage: Confusing signs and inadequate lighting can increase the risk of wrong-way accidents.
  • Road Design: Poor road design can also contribute to wrong-way accidents. Confusing ramps, inadequate markings, and a lack of barriers can cause drivers, particularly new ones, to end up on the wrong side of the road.
  • Weather Conditions: Bad weather, such as rain, fog, or snow, can make it difficult to see signs and markings, increasing the likelihood of drivers accidentally going the wrong way.
  • Vehicle Malfunction: Driving the wrong way or vehicle malfunctions can also cause accidents. This can include following inaccurate GPS directions or experiencing a sudden tire blowout.

Consequences of Head-On Collisions

While only accounting for 1% of all crashes in the U.S., wrong-way collisions are responsible for 2% of all crash-related deaths. These types of accidents occur more frequently on weekends and at night and often involve alcohol impairment, leading to head-on collisions.

The consequences of such incidents can be devastating, resulting in severe injuries to the head and spinal cord, fractured bones, internal organs, and even fatalities. Due to the high speeds involved, wrong-way accidents are particularly dangerous, making it difficult for other drivers to react in time. Moreover, head-on collisions also pose an increased risk of ejection from the vehicle, which can lead to fatal injuries.

Steps to Take After a Wrong-Way Collision

In the unfortunate event of a wrong-way accident, it is essential to take the following steps to guarantee everyone’s safety and well-being:

  1. First, check for injuries and seek immediate medical attention if necessary.
  2. Call 911 to request assistance from law enforcement.
  3. Remain at the scene until law enforcement arrives unless you require immediate medical attention.
  4. Exchange contact and insurance information with the other parties involved.
  5. Take photos of the scene to provide further evidence.
  6. Collect witness information to help with any legal proceedings.
